A 1986 Ford F-350 may experience vapor lock if the fuel line is exposed to excessive heat. This allows the fuel to boil and prevents the carburetor from receiving a constant supply of fuel.
Fuel vapor lock in a Ford Focus occurs when the fuel in the lines or the fuel delivery system vaporizes due to high temperatures, causing a temporary blockage that prevents liquid fuel from reaching the engine. This can happen in hot weather, after prolonged engine operation, or if there are issues with the fuel pump or fuel system components. Insufficient fuel pressure, low-quality fuel, or a malfunctioning fuel pressure regulator can also contribute to this problem. Proper maintenance and ensuring the fuel system is functioning correctly are key to preventing vapor lock.

To fix an air lock in a Ford 6610, start by identifying the source of the air in the fuel system. Begin by checking the fuel lines, filters, and connections for any leaks or blockages. Then, loosen the fuel line fittings at the injectors to allow trapped air to escape while cranking the engine. Once fuel flows steadily without bubbles, retighten the fittings and start the engine; it should run smoothly if the air lock is cleared.
